£10,000 WON BY LIFTMASTER
DISTRIBUTION PLAN ANNOUNCED £lOOO TO BE GIVEN TO N.Z. CHARITY (N.Z.P.A.—Reuter—Copyright) THE HAGUE, October 11. Dr. Albert Plesman. president and director of Royal Dutch' Airlines, today announced the distribution of the £ 10,000 won by the airlines’ Liftmaster plane in the London-Christchurch air race. The sum of £lOOO is to be made available to a charitable institution in New Zealand. Each of the 54 emigrants who were passengers in the aircraft is to receive £lO. Fifteen per cent, of the gross amount of the prize will be divided among the crew of the Liftmaster, and the rest is to go to the airlines’ staff fund for special needs.
